    And the news keep coming in…Andy Biersack announced the release date of the first record of his solo project Andy Black. The record will be out May 6th  worldwide. It’s called ‘The Shadow Side’.   The album cover was designed and executed by Biersacks longtime friend, Richard Villa III, who did all the art work for Black Veil Brides too in the past. Pre-orders can already be placed via www.andyblackmusic.com. There’s a limited edition of signed CD’s. I’m pretty sure there’s going to be a run for that. As if recording two records at the same time and a solo tour ain’t enough, Andy Biersack will also be starring in a movie called ‘American Satan’. It also features Ben Bruce, Malcolm McDowell, Denise Richards and many more. The thriller is about a young rock band, half from the UK, half from the US, dropping out of high school and moving to the Sunset Strip to chase their dream. The multi-platinum rockers Candlebox have just released a new song, I’ve Got a Gun which is off their highly anticipated album, Disappearing in Airports, set for an April 22nd release. Vocalist Kevin Martin explains, “‘I’ve Got a Gun’ is inspired by the constant small-mindedness of people who think you’re trying to take their guns away from them. If you know anything about me as a person, you know that I’m highly political; you know that I’m a firm believer in people’s rights 100% and I don’t believe that anyone should take your guns from you. I’m saying is, gun control is an issue and these mass shootings need to stop and that’s the approach of the song.” Check out the new song here: You can pre-order the album and pick up a couple of the tracks instantly by heading over to iTunes here. The Hard rockers Crossing Rubicon from Bristol, CT have just released a new music video for their bad ass song Unhinged. Crossing Rubicon features ex-All That Remains bassist, Jeanne Sagan and the song is off their new twelve track album, No Less Than Anything. Vocalist Scott Anarchy explains, “In a time where kids are being raised by television, smart phones, and social networking, we want to show that people – kids especially – can still find passion and empathy through music and a music scene. The world may treat you like you don’t exist, but music will always be there to speak to you and vent your frustrations, and there is always a scene of people who believe in this, and who will be there for you as well.“ Check out the video here: The album features twelve hard rockin tracks that brings the vibe of 80’s to 90’s metal to life with a modern rock flair.
